For the 2025-26 school year, there are 6 public middle schools serving 2,424 students in 87106, NM.
The top-ranked public middle schools in 87106, NM are Albuquerque Institute Of Math & Science, Jefferson Middle School and Mission Achievement And Success 1.0.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public middle schools in zipcode 87106 have an average math proficiency score of 43% (versus the New Mexico public middle school average of 24%), and reading proficiency score of 49% (versus the 34% statewide average). Middle schools in 87106, NM have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of New Mexico public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 84%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the New Mexico public middle school average of 78% (majority Hispanic).
